Comments First non diving trip, now snorkeling only. Three days of two or three snorkeling dives. Three days of shore dives on light snorkeling package. Great reefs, great small fish, some tuna, bonito, lots of schools of exotic reef fish. Turtles common. No sharks. No big rays. Scorpionfish, crocodile flatfish, lots of life to see. Wished guide would slow down. The best experience was when we would stop and watch gobi shrimp digging their den or large shrimp roaming the reef. Outstanding service all around, on the boat and in the resort. I enjoyed the behind the scenes tour and the village tour. 250 employees to run this resort. Food was very good. They are building a new restaurant building, we were fine with present arrangement. Reverse osmosis water filtering for drinking water. (Do not drink the water in Bali where you need to overnight!)

Dive Conditions

Weather sunny, windy, dry Seas calm
Water Temp 85-88°F / 29-31°C Wetsuit Thickness 3
Water Visibility 50-150 Ft/ 15-46 M

Dive Policy

Dive own profile yes
Enforced diving restrictions stay within buoys at the front of resort on shore dives. Guided snorkelling on boat dives.
